The Untouchables: A Hollywood Pressure Cooker
When The Untouchables hit theaters in 1987, audiences were captivated.
Directed by Brian De Palma, written by David Mamet, and starring Kevin Costner, Sean Connery, Robert De Niro, and Andy García, the film was destined for greatness.
It had style, grit, and performances that pushed each actor to the edge.
But behind the polished cinematography and razor-sharp dialogue, the set itself was reportedly filled with tension.
Costner was a rising star, still carving out his place in Hollywood, while Connery was already a legend, carrying the weight of James Bond and decades of cinematic dominance.

The Oscar That Changed Everything
One undeniable fact about The Untouchables is that it brought Sean Connery an Academy Award for Best Supporting Actor.
His portrayal of Jim Malone remains one of his most celebrated performances.
For Costner, this moment was bittersweet.
On one hand, he was thrilled to share the screen with a legend who was being recognized for his brilliance.
On the other, the Oscar highlighted just how far he still had to go.
Yet Costner didn’t have to wait long for his own glory.
Just a few years later, he would direct and star in Dances with Wolves, a film that swept the Oscars and established him as one of Hollywood’s most powerful figures.
